Indulge in Unique Kosher Brunch and Wine Bar at Bat Harim in Zichron Ya’akov

Dining travel guide

Address: Ha-Nadiv St 23, Zikhron Ya'akov

Phone: 079-6100100

Looking for a delicious and unique brunch spot? Look no further than Bat Harim, a kosher restaurant located in Zichron Ya’akov. This charming eatery offers a brunch menu from 8:00 AM to 6:00 PM, and transforms into a wine bar and restaurant with an elevated menu after 7:00 PM.

The standout feature of Bat Harim is their use of independent produce. All of their cheeses come from the Bat Harim dairy on the Lebanese border, where they’re made with natural ingredients and no preservatives. The wines served in the restaurant come from the family-owned Avivim Winery, which has been producing wine for four generations. The winery sources grapes from vineyards in the north of the Upper Galilee to Mount Miron and offers unique varieties such as Barbara, Malbec, and Neviolo.

The menu at Bat Harim offers a wide range of delicious dishes for diners to choose from. For wine enthusiasts, there are wine tastings available for one, three, five, or eight types of wine, ranging from NIS 85 to NIS 300. The cheese tasting platters are also worth trying, with options for four or six types of cheese, or up to ten types of cheese for a more extensive tasting. Those looking for a full dining experience can opt for the tasting meal, which includes chef dishes, cheese tasting palettes, and paired wine tastings. For main courses, there are options from the sea and from the field, as well as Italian-inspired dishes, including tortellini, ravioli, and risotto. Lastly, dessert options include crumbles of panna cotta, caramelized persimmons, and brown butter ice cream. Whether you’re a wine lover, cheese enthusiast, or looking for a full dining experience, Bat Harim has something for everyone.

Overall, Bat Harim is a unique and delicious brunch spot that offers a range of dishes using high-quality ingredients. With its charming ambiance and great service, it’s a must-visit destination for foodies in Zichron Ya’akov.

Shishko Tel Aviv: A Blend of Bulgarian Menu and Tel Aviv Fun

Shishko is a restaurant located in Tel Aviv that offers a unique culinary experience by blending Bulgarian cuisine with the lively atmosphere of the city. The restaurant is an excellent choice for anyone who loves Balkan food, a lively environment, and good drinks. The combination of great food, good people, and alcohol makes Shishko a perfect destination for anyone who wants to have a good time. One of the highlights of Shishko is their Bulgarian Mazets. Served every day, these dishes are fresh and delicious, offering a true taste of Bulgaria. The menu is simple, yet elegant, and features a range of dishes that will delight any food lover. Shishko's chefs take pride in using fresh and local ingredients to create the perfect blend of flavors. However, Shishko is not just about the food. The restaurant also offers a lively and welcoming atmosphere that reflects the spirit of Tel Aviv. The city is known for its diverse population and lively energy, and Shishko is no exception. The restaurant is located in a vibrant area and attracts a diverse crowd, making it a perfect place to hang out and enjoy the city's energy. The restaurant's atmosphere is also enhanced by the authentic and happy music that plays at a volume that allows for comfortable conversation. The music adds to the overall ambiance of the restaurant, creating a warm and welcoming environment that will make you want to stay longer. Whether you are looking for a romantic dinner for two or a night out with friends, Shishko is the perfect destination. The restaurant offers a range of seating options, from intimate tables to larger group settings, making it a perfect venue for any occasion. In summary, Shishko is a perfect blend of Bulgarian cuisine and Tel Aviv fun. The restaurant offers a unique culinary experience, featuring fresh and delicious dishes served alongside a sea of alcohol. However, the atmosphere is just as important as the food, and Shishko's lively and welcoming environment makes it a perfect destination for anyone looking to experience the energy and diversity of Tel Aviv.

Marsha Winery: Introducing High-Quality Wines in a Developing Wine Region

In a new and developing wine region, Marsha Winery is a kosher family winery producing high quality wines. With its mission to transmit wine culture and introduce new flavors and aromas to Israeli wine, Marsha Winery aims to be the center for the transmission of wine culture. Near Nahal Govrin, the vineyard, winery, and visitor center are located in "Givaot Yehuda-Tel Marsha." The coastal plain, the Judean Mountains, and the Lachish region form this region of land. There are limestone hills and low limestones in the area that rise from 30 to 60 meters above sea level, and clay soils mixed with chalk can be found along the rivers and in the plains between them. In front of us is the creation of a new, unique terroir that produces high-quality, regional wines. Since the winery is an ESTATE WINERY, and the winery strives to "grow the wine on the vine", the wines are made exclusively from grapes grown in the vineyard owned by the winery. This way we can guarantee the uniqueness of the flavors and the characteristic aromas obtained from the grapes.. "Tel-Marsha" (the site of the caves of Beit Gobrin), the ancient biblical city mentioned in the Bible, as well as Josephus Flavius as a dominant and busy district city, provides the source of Nahal Gobrin, which passes near the winery. Between the mild clay and the kurkar hills typical of the region, the stream meanders.. The combination of low yields and pruning during all stages of growth, along with the hot summer climate and humid conditions typical of the area, produce intense flavors and aromas in the grapes and wine. The vineyard and the winery the wines "Nahal Gubrin" is a blend of Pinotage and Syrah grapes. The Pinotage variety has proven to be a promising success in the region. The resulting wine is a complex wine with character, rich in aromas of red fruits, truffles, and herbs. "Syrah, Cabernet Sauvignon and Merlot are crossed in order to create Tel Marsha. Syrah grapes fermented in open tanks contribute an additional layer of complexity and meaty aromas. The Cabernet Sauvignon grapes fermented in tanks were macerated with the skins for another week. A bit of history… The winery is located in a land formerly known as "Fields of Palestine". It was formerly a buffer zone between Judea and Palestine, where Jews and Philistines lived in the city of Erububia alternately during the ancient period. According to the researchers, Tel Tzfit is the biblical city of Gath, where King David fled, behaving like a madman before Acish the king of Gath.. These days, archaeological excavations in the area of Moshav Zarhia where the winery operates (about 200 meters from the winery's gates) have revealed the remains of an ancient settlement which, according to the findings, dates back to the Byzantine period in the 7th century AD. Moshav Zarhia has an impressive wine cellar measuring approximately 15x15 meters with a mosaic floor and a system for dripping and pooling liquids.. Brut wine bar, Tel Aviv

If you're looking for a truly unique dining experience, look no further than Brut. This restaurant's cuisine is inspired by the classic French and Italian kitchens, but with a Middle Eastern twist. You'll find ingredients like lamb and yogurt from Nazareth, fruit and vegetables from Hebron, and spices from Tel Aviv's Levinsky Market. The menu features both classic dishes and seasonal creations, often invented the same day they're served. And the wine list is a love letter to all things French and Italian, with a focus on small-scale producers and Israeli wineries. Brut is an ongoing celebration of local terroir, and you won't find anything else quite like it. Brut is small, deeply personal wine bistro in Tel Aviv, founded by yair yosefi and omer ben gal. Brut's cuisine is inspired by Yair and Omer's shared love of the classic French and Italian kitchens, while remaining steadfastly rooted in local Middle Eastern tradition. The ingredients used in Brut are sourced from the Levant, including lamb and yogurt from Nazareth, fruit and vegetables from Hebron, and spices from Tel Aviv's Levinsky Market. There is a stable of classic dishes as well as an ever-changing selection of seasonal dishes, often created the very same day. In a similar way, Brut's extensive wine list is a love letter to all things French and Italian while also highlighting Israel's emerging winemakers. They also work with Israeli wineries on blends that are grown and bottled exclusively for Brut, which are imported from small-scale producers in Bourgogne and Piedmont. Local terroir is celebrated and examined in Brut. Along with the physical land and its raw materials, this also includes the culture, communities, and yes, even conflicts that have influenced the land's character."
